Country Style Peppered Pork And Bread Stuffing

⏱Time: 2 hr
A great old fashioned stuffing recipe to serve with your thanksgiving turkey! From bon apetit.

Ingredients

  • White Bread
  • Butter
  • Olive Oil
  • Onions
  • Celery
  • Fresh Sage
  • Dry White Wine
  • Ground Pork
  • Fresh Parsley
  • Celery Leaves
  • Eggs
  • Salt
  • Ground Nutmeg
  • Ground Black Pepper
  • Low Sodium Chicken Broth

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350
  2. Spread bread on 2 large rimmed baking sheets
  3. Bake until golden brown, stirring occasionally, about 30 minutes
  4. Transfer to a large bowl
  5. Melt butter with oil in heavy large skillet over medium-high heat
  6. Add onions and celery and saute until tender, about 8 minutes
  7. Add sage
  8. Saute 1 minute
  9. Add wine
  10. Boil until wine evaporates, about 1 minute
  11. Add pork and cook until brown and cooked through, breaking up with back of fork, about 4 minutes
  12. Cool slightly
  13. Stir pork mixture, parsley and celery leaves into bread cubes
  14. Whisk eggs, salt, nutmeg and pepper in medium bowl
  15. Mix into stuffing
  16. To bake stuffing in turkey: loosely fill main turkey cavity with stuffing
  17. Add enough broth to remaining stuffing to moisten lightly
  18. Generously butter glass or ceramic baking dish
  19. Spoon remaining stuffing into dish
  20. Cover with buttered foil, buttered side down
  21. Bake stuffing in dish alongside turkey until heated through, about 30 minutes
  22. Uncover stuffing
  23. Bake until top is just crisp and golden, about 15 minutes
  24. To bake all of stuffing in baking dish: preheat oven to 350
  25. Generously butter a 13x9x2-inch square glass or ceramic baking dish
  26. Add enough broth to stuffing to moisten transfer stuffing to prepared dish
  27. Cover with buttered foil, buttered side down
  28. Bake until heated through, about 30 minutes
  29. Uncover and bake until top is crisp and golden, about 20 minutes longer
